Remove UB from indeterminate value handling
Move SIMD operations on potentially-indeterminate Node16::index bytes into file-level assembly, where loading and operating on indeterminate values is well-defined (unlike C++). Restructure scalar fallback loops to iterate [0, numChildren) instead of [0, kMaxNodes). Fix TrivialSpan construction from indeterminate pointers in check::Job::init and insertPointWritesOrSorted to only construct when end.len > 0. Add MSan toolchain to the debug CI build to catch these issues going forward.
